Transaction 06c771c2b64a3bff1557c6789a87c14c422248b250cd557c2c751129cecf41c8
2 Input
2 Outputs
- 06c771c2b64a3bff1557c6789a87c14c422248b250cd557c2c751129cecf41c8:0
- 06c771c2b64a3bff1557c6789a87c14c422248b250cd557c2c751129cecf41c8:1
value 1538047
address 3MRtKwJbtUX1N1E6VcGZi9JLFDeaityg76
value 70552011
address 15epBtonhwkDAi5TFuU9Zn5Q5fermnFoHv